WebApr 11, 2024 · The Art Gallery of South Australia, which has more than 100 works from the collective in its collection, including work from Young, said they would not be conducting … WebMar 30, 2024 · In addition to offering compelling information to historians and art lovers, provenance often plays a central role in ownership disputes. Essentially, you cannot demand the return of an object, if it wasn’t yours to begin with. Without proof of ownership, a party lacks legal standing to successfully make a claim for restitution. WebProvenance: An Alternate History of Art. This book goes beyond the narrow definition of the term provenance, which addresses only the bare facts of ownership and transfer, to explore ideas about the origins and itineraries of objects, consider the historical uses of provenance research, and draw attention to the transformative power of ownership. Some also include biographical information, interpretive essays and comprehensive catalogue entries. steren contacto wifiProvenance (from the French provenir, 'to come from/forth') is the chronology of the ownership, custody or location of a historical object. The term was originally mostly used in relation to works of art but is now used in similar senses in a wide range of fields, including archaeology, paleontology, archives, manuscripts, printed books, the circular economy, and science and computing.
